    1、Best Practices Entry: Best Practice Info:a71 Committee Approval Date: 2000-04-18a71 Center Point of Contact: GSFCa71 Submitted by: Wil HarkinsSubject: Qualification of Nonstandard Electrical, Electronic, and Electromechanical (EEE) Parts in Spaceflight Applications Practice: The source for selection

    2、 of acceptable flight quality EEE parts for use on Goddard projects is the GSFC Preferred Parts List (PPL-20) (Reference 2). PPL-20 complements NASA Standard Electrical, Electronic, and Electromechanical (EEE) Parts List (NSPL) (MIL-STD-975) (Reference 1) by listing additional part types and part ca

    3、tegories not included in MIL-STD-975. Recognizing that it is neither possible nor desirable to include all parts in the GSFC PPL and in the NSPL, the GSFC parts requirements make provision that limited numbers of parts not included in the PPL or the NSPL may be used if it is demonstrated that the pa

    4、rts are acceptable (Reference 5, section 5). The acceptability of nonstandard parts is enhanced by use of the part procurement specifications provided in Appendix E of PPL-20. The acceptability of these nonstandard parts must be demonstrated prior to commitment to design or use. Requests for approva

    5、l to use nonstandard parts with supporting documentation are forwarded to the appropriate GSFC Project Office for review and approval. The practice described herein is used for demonstrating and documenting the acceptability of nonstandard parts for space flight use.Programs that Certify Usage: GFSC

    6、 spaceflight projects approve the use of nonstandard parts on a per case basis.Center to Contact for Information: GSFCImplementation Method: This Lesson Learned is based on Reliability Practice number PT-TE-1418 from NASA Technical Provided by IHSNot for ResaleNo reproduction or networking permitted

    7、 without license from IHS-,-,-Memorandum 4322A, NASA Reliability Preferred Practices for Design and Test.Benefit:The practice of using approved nonstandard parts that have been appropriately demonstrated to be acceptable for the applications provides for a wider range of parts selection than are ava

    8、ilable with standard parts. These parts are at a quality level equal to that of Grades 1 or 2 standard parts.Implementation Method:Any EEE part that does not meet the criteria of a NASA Standard Part by being listed in the NASA Standard Parts List (NSPL) or the Preferred Parts List (PPL) is a nonsta

    9、ndard part that must be reviewed and accepted prior to use. It is the responsibility of the activity selecting the nonstandard part to demonstrate acceptability of the part prior to committing it to a design. Contractors document and approve their selection, application, evaluation, and acceptance c

    10、riteria for nonstandard parts on a GSFC Form 4-15 (see Figures 1 & 2), Nonstandard Parts Approval Request (NSPAR)(Reference 5). The NSPAR forms are forwarded to the GSFC Project Office for review and GSFC approval. Figure 3 depicts the process flow of the nonstandard parts approval process.Provided

    13、ng permitted without license from IHS-,-,-Nonstandard Parts Specifications:Nonstandard parts must be at a quality level equal to that of Grade 1 or 2 standard parts and are procured in accordance with military, NASA, or contractor controlled specifications prepared in accordance with MIL-STD-490. Sp

    14、ecifications for nonstandard parts are equal to the requirements of the nearest applicable standard part.Specifications and drawings fully identify the item being procured and include the physical, electrical, and environmental test requirements and quality assurance provisions including parts scree

    15、ning necessary to control manufacturing and acceptance. Specifications also describe marking, handling, packaging, storage of parts and the criteria for testing of parts taken from storage, and address environmental controls for temperature, humidity, particulate contamination, and controls for elec

    16、trostatic discharge (ESD) for parts which are susceptible to ESD damage.Parts Qualification and Quality Conformance Inspection:Nonstandard parts have qualification bases traceable to test and inspection data at the part level in a manner consistent with the specification requirements of the nearest

    17、standard parts. The qualification is based on parts which have been produced by the same manufacturer using the same manufacturing technology as the nonstandard parts for which approval is being sought. Nonstandard parts undergo quality conformance inspection consistent with the specification requir

    18、ements of the nearest standard parts.Hybrid Microcircuits:Hybrid microcircuits that are not included in the NSPL or the PPL are subject to nonstandard parts control. Their selection and approval is consistent with the requirements of MIL-H-38534B, General Specification for Microcircuits.Additional P

    19、arts Requirements Applicable to Nonstandard Parts:The following additional requirements pertain to nonstandard parts as applicable: Derating, Radiation Hardness, Screening Verification Tests, Destructive Physical Analyses, and Parts Identification List (Reference 5).Technical Rationale:The competent

    20、 selection and acceptance of the proper EEE Parts for spaceflight use is an essential part of design of spacecraft hardware. With the rapidly growing availability of EEE parts that perform major system functions, the selection of parts has become a mainstream activity of electronic design. Further,
